Inspection Results

* Assistant director Bill Ford makes the Orange County Health Care Agency sound like a bunch of moronic bureaucrats in the Nov. 9 article “Inspections but No Grades for O.C. Eateries.”

Ford maintains that grades should not be posted in windows because the grade isn’t necessarily an accurate reflection of conditions at any given time. It’s better to see the results of the inspection, and surely would motivate restaurateurs to keep their places cleaner and healthier.
